This AutoCAD drawing presents a 39-foot continuous beam section view designed for residential house construction, focusing on structural clarity and reinforcement accuracy. The drawing clearly illustrates beam continuity across multiple supports, showing detailed reinforcement bar placement, stirrup arrangement, cover dimensions, and sectional profiles required for safe load transfer. All measurement details are precisely mentioned, allowing architects and civil engineers to understand span lengths, beam depths, reinforcement spacing, and alignment without ambiguity. This CAD file is ideal for structural planning, detailing, and coordination during house-building projects where accurate beam detailing is critical.
The continuous beam CAD drawing also includes reinforcement notation, sectional cuts, and dimensional annotations that help professionals interpret construction intent easily. Builders and designers can use this file to review beam layout, verify reinforcement detailing, and integrate it with architectural or structural layouts. The drawing supports professional workflows in AutoCAD and is suitable for practical execution, estimation, and design validation.
